What Makes Megalodon Tooth Ledges So Unique

Unlike riverbeds or loose offshore deposits, megalodon tooth ledges form along ancient seabed layers where sediment accumulates gradually and consistently. These underwater shelves trap teeth shortly after they fall from the shark’s jaw, limiting movement and shielding them from harsh abrasion. As a result, teeth remain stable rather than tumbling through sand and rock.

Because currents move gently across these ledges, collectors often recover teeth with minimal river polish, crisp edges, and original surface texture. This stability preserves the tooth exactly as it fossilized millions of years ago, creating specimens that appeal strongly to high-end collectors.

Geological Conditions That Protect Tooth Integrity

Sediment composition plays a critical role in preservation. Megalodon tooth ledges typically consist of compacted clay, limestone, and fine sand rather than coarse gravel. These materials cushion the teeth and prevent impact damage. Over time, sediment layers seal the fossils in place, protecting delicate features.

Teeth from ledge environments frequently display intact serrations, glossy enamel, and fully preserved roots. For investors, these features directly influence market value. Sharp serrations indicate limited wear, while solid roots confirm that the tooth avoided breakage during fossilization.

Reduced Abrasion Compared to River Finds

River-recovered teeth often suffer from heavy tumbling, which rounds serrations and dulls enamel. In contrast, megalodon tooth ledges reduce this constant motion. Teeth rest within stable layers instead of rolling along the bottom, which explains their superior definition.

Collectors immediately notice the difference. Ledge-sourced teeth show stronger contrast in enamel color, clearer bourlette definition, and sharper cutting edges. These traits enhance both display quality and long-term appreciation.

Scientific and Educational Significance

Beyond aesthetics, ledge teeth offer clearer insight into megalodon biology. Preserved serrations reveal feeding behavior, while intact roots help researchers understand tooth replacement patterns. Fossils recovered from these ledges often appear alongside other marine species, painting a detailed picture of ancient ocean ecosystems.
